Harvard Won't Clear Away Sackler Name coming from Craft Gallery as well as University Property

.Harvard College will certainly certainly not get rid of the title Arthur M. Sackler from some of its three fine art galleries as well as another campus building.
Recommendations in a latest file concluded an extensive project by pupil lobbyists intended for distancing the Ivy League college coming from the household which owned Purdue Pharma.
In October 2022, the team Harvard College Overdose Prevention and Learning Pupils submitted a 23-page proposal seeking the elimination of Sackler's name. A committee consisted of initially of educational institution managers were actually not urged due to the featured debates, according to The Harvard Crimson, which to begin with stated the news.

" The board was not convinced by the plan's disagreements that denaming pertains considering that Arthur Sackler's label is actually spoiled through affiliation with various other members of the Sackler family members or because Arthur Sackler allotments obligation for the opioid problems due to his having developed threatening pharmaceutical advertising and marketing approaches that ill-treated after his death," the board's document said.
Last month, the Harvard Organization, the university's highest possible controling physical body, allowed the committee's finding that it did certainly not encourage the elimination of Arthur M. Sackler's name.
Arthur M. Sackler contributed $10.7 million to Harvard College in 1985, which made it possible for the opening of the namesake museum dedicated to jobs coming from Asia, the Center East, as well as the Mediterranean on the college school. The structure was actually developed through English engineer James Sterling.
Sackler perished in 1987, 9 years before the family members's pharmaceutical company Purdue Pharma started selling OxyContin, a prescribed pain reliever along with addictive properties. Some protestors have considered the company and the medication to be synonymous along with the opioid wide-ranging, causing objections at museums and social institutions birthing the Sackler name coming from significant contributions.
The label extraction proposition from Harvard College Overdose Prevention and also Education Students likewise mentioned that while Arthur died prior to the manufacturing and also purchase of OxyContin, he advanced marketing methods that helped in the medication's growth.
In 2023, freelance photographer Nan Goldin and the anti-Sackler protest group ache led a die-in objection in the room of the Arthur M. Sackler Gallery at Harvard.
The board's 15-page rumor ended that Sackler's individual connection to the opioid prevalent was also weak to warrant the removal of his image from the namesake craft museum as well as the other property on Harvard's grounds.
" Arthur Sackler's legacy is actually sophisticated, unclear, and also open to question," the file said. "The denaming choice should be located only on the actions, inactiveness or terms of Arthur Sackler. Appreciation for one's personal identity is a vital canon and component of the values of our culture.".
The board also filled in the report that it wanted to stress its recommendation should not be actually taken an exoneration or an endorsement of Sackler's activities, noting his alleged roles in medical rumors. It also suggest the educational institution apply to communicate Arthur Sackler's "complicated life and tradition", recommending explanatory text message on the fine art museum's website and also uploaded in famous sites within the structures called after him.
" By means of such contextualization, individuals will definitely be enabled to establish their very own judgments regarding Arthur Sackler and also the identifying," the report stated.
Regardless of whether the board had coincided the 2022 proposition, the educational institution is matched to specific health conditions outlined in a present agreement when it accepted Sackler's gift of funds in 1982, which the Harvard Crimson noted is actually not openly offered.
Harvard College's decision to maintain Arthur M. Sackler's label on some of its three craft museums and also a campus structure is notable for how Tufts University decided to eliminate the family members's title coming from its systems as well as amenities in 2019.
